Default YS170 high speed needle valve setting



I have a new YS170 with some bench time and three flights on it. I have a hard time figuring out if I have the high speed needle valve set right. I how you should find the high speed RPM peak and back off a few 100 RPM, but I don&rsquo;t have much luck doing that.</p>

It seem like when I am trying to peak the RPM, the engine is slowing down because it is warming up, so there is not much constancy between the RPM and needle valve setting. Maybe I am not giving it enough time to heat up completely.</p>

I must be running it rich enough at two turns open. It burns through 20oz of fuel in a 10 minute flight and has a good smoke trail.</p>

The other details about my setup are: I am using a NMP can muffler and velocity stack. I get around 8300 RPM with an APC 17x12 prop and 30% Cool Power Heli fuel. I am at about 5000&rsquo; altitude and the engine is in an EF Yak 54 74&rdquo; weighing about 12.5 lbs.
